Juniper Networks shrinks IP Communication
Juniper Networks Inc, announced today they are introducing a slew of new apps and services for its customers. Notably these services deliver voice, video and other multimedia in a way that requires less bandwidth.
Juniper’s applications can combine multiple voice calls into a single IP packet, rather than each call having its own packet. This effectively eliminates the additional headers, and other packet transmission information that would be required with the former method, allowing for much sleeker IP communication. Let it also be known that Juniper does not deem this VoIP but rather “circuit emulation”. Their circuit emulation is a new approach on IP Communication, it should offer an interesting alternative to current standards.
There are also plans in the future to release a gateway solution for legacy analog systems to use Juniper’s new IP communication technology. The technology will use Junipers circuit emulation with a mix of current standards based Session Border Controllers.
